Hello React - composite components - composing components with behavior - working solution. author(s): Ryan Vice
by Abid Akhtar
HTML
<script src="https://fb.me/react-with-addons-0.14.0.js"></script>
<script src="https://fb.me/react-dom-0.14.0.js"></script>
<div id="view"/>
Babel + JSX
var HelloMessage = React.createClass({
render: function() {
return <h2>{this.props.message}</h2>;
}
});
var TextBox = React.createClass({
getInitialState: function() {
return { isEditing: false }
},
update: function() {
this.props.update(this.refs.messageTextBox.value);
this.setState(
{
isEditing: false
});
},
edit: function() {
this.setState({ isEditing: true});
},
render: function() {
return (
<div>
{this.props.label}<br/>
<input type='text' ref='messageTextBox' disabled={!this.state.isEditing}/>
{
this.state.isEditing ?
<button onClick={this.update}>Update</button>
:
<button onClick={this.edit}>Edit</button>
}
</div>
);
}
});
var HelloReact = React.createClass({
getInitialState: function () {
return { firstName: '', lastName: ''}
},
update: function(key, value) {
var newState = {};
newState[key] = value;
this.setState(newState);
},
render: function() {
return (
<div>
<HelloMessage
message={'Hello ' + this.state.firstName + ' ' + this.state.lastName}>
</HelloMessage>
<TextBox label='First Name' update={this.update.bind(null, 'firstName')}>
</TextBox>
<TextBox label='Last Name'
update={this.update.bind(null, 'lastName')}>
</TextBox>
</div>
);
}
});
ReactDOM.render(
<HelloReact/>,
document.getElementById('view'));
